I have installed WG 6.0.1.9 a few days ago and it works fine. Great product. No doubt.
I would like to restrict users to a list of website. So they can only visit google, yahoo, etc...
They can access to WG through WGIC. I stopped www proxy server, ftp proxy server and socks proxy server services.
I read in knowledge base "Blocking client access to Specific URL's and Sites", and I tried many test to understand the criterion behaviour of the policies of WRSP. Well... I am in trouble. It sound like a bug (or I am very very tired ?).
What I did :
In WRSP Policies, I put Default rights to "are ignored", created recipient "Everyone" and in advanced choose "Specify wich requests ..."
Then :
Test 0) No Criterion
=> I try to access google, or any other site, and all this sites are reachable. Fine. Let's start.
Test 1) Criterion = "server name contains google"
=> I try to access google, or any other site, and then WIC ERROR : "You have not been granted rights...". Oups.
Test 2) Criterion = "NOT server name contains google"
=> I try to access google, or any other site, and all this sites are reachable. ???
Test 3) Criterion = "server name begins with google"
=> I try to access google, or any other site, and then WIC ERROR : "You have not been granted rights...".
Test 4) Criterion = "NOT server name begins with google"
=> I try to access google, or any other site, and all this sites are reachable.
etc.. etc...
I tried about 12 or 14 differents tests, with new criterion using Google, google.com, http://google.com, even "g" or "G" and I could never differentiate google from any other URL.
So no way to restrict my user to a list of site.
Details :
- I dont have any users created. Everything is under "Guest".
- Everything works fine if I dont use criterions
Any idea ?